
Isabela Chess University Wins Region 2 Chess League Title

Isabela Chess University (ICU) capped a remarkable and dominant weekend after emerging as the overall champion of the Region 2 Chess League, a highly competitive tournament composed of seven legs and featuring more than 20 teams from across the region.
After the completion of the seven-leg series, only the top eight teams qualified for the quarterfinals, which were held on December 21, 2025, at New Market, Alicia, Isabela. The knockout stage brought together the strongest teams in the league and produced intense and closely fought matches.
Isabela Chess University delivered an impressive run in the elimination rounds, first eliminating CAPCA Team B, then overcoming Isabela Chess University Team B to book a place in the finals.
In the championship match, ICU faced tournament favorite Kidz Chess Club Tuguegarao City. Showcasing superior preparation, discipline, and teamwork, Isabela Chess University dominated the finals and clinched the championship with a decisive 5.5–1.5 victory.
The championship-winning Isabela Chess University Team A was composed of Penelope Kate Sanchez, Davyd Leiniel C. Sigua, Roldio Torres, John Carlo Gauan, Alaine Ibadlit, Dwayne Mesia, and Seth Esteban.
Meanwhile, Isabela Chess University Team B earned praise for finishing 4th overall, despite being widely considered underdogs throughout the tournament. Team B’s strong showing underscored the depth of talent within the university’s chess program. Its members were Arbie Obana, Jheryl Ruiz, Jared Keanne B. Cudal, Sebastian James B. Cudal, Anika Caole, Russell Martinez, and Nicos Ibana.
Adding to ICU’s outstanding weekend, the university also dominated the side events held alongside the league finals. International Master and FIDE Trainer Joel Banawa, head coach of Isabela Chess University, captured the Year-End Rapid Championship, posting an impressive 6.5 points out of 7.
Further success came in the youth category as Naphtali Ruano of Isabela Chess University claimed the Under-17 Rapid Championship, finishing with a strong 6 out of 7 points.
With victories across team and individual events, the weekend proved to be a total domination for Isabela Chess University, firmly establishing the institution as a major force in both regional and developmental chess in Region 2.-Marlon Bernardino-
